What would ΔG∘′ be for an enzyme that oxidizes succinate with NAD+ instead of FAD?

Oxidant Reductant n E∘′(V)
NAD++H++2e− NADH 2 −0.32
Fumarate+2H++2e− Succinate 2 0.03


Use the following equation and F = 96.485 kJ/mol.

ΔG°’ = ‒nFΔE°’

Express your answer to two significant figures and include the appropriate units

ΔG′=      value w/ units please

Answer #1

NADH -------------> NAD++H++2e−               E0   = 0.32v

Fumarate+2H++2e− ----> Succinate                E0   = 0.03v

-------------------------------------------------------------------------------------

NADH + Fumarate + H^+ -----------> NAD+ + Succinate     ΔE°’    = 0.35v

n = 2

F = 96.485 kJ/mol.

ΔG°’ = ‒nFΔE°’

          = -2*96.485*0.35

             = -68KJ/mole >>>>answer
